WebThe University of Tampa's Dickey Health and Wellness Center offers testing for chlamydia, gonorrhea, HIV, RPR (Syphilis) and HSV (Herpes Simplex Virus). For up-to-date information on these and other sexually transmitted diseases, visit CDC Website.
